Dans Windows, je fais un clic droit et il y a une option pour créer un fichier texte.
Comment le faire dans Mac ?
Dans Windows, je fais un clic droit et il y a une option pour créer un fichier texte.
Comment le faire dans Mac ?
Vérifiez ma réponse à - SuperUser .
NOTE : Après l'introduction de SIP, cette application ne no fonctionne sauf si vous le désactivez. Lire la suite sur la façon de le faire, mais c'est peu judicieux.
Essayez XtraFinder .
Cette application est tout simplement géniale, elle a répondu à tous mes besoins de base après être passé d'une plateforme Windows, comme l'ajout de "Nouveau fichier" dans le menu contextuel et la barre d'outils du Finder, etc. Voici quelques-unes des caractéristiques énumérées sur le site Web de l'application.
XtraFinder ajoute des onglets et des fonctionnalités au Finder de Mac.
- Onglets et double panneau.
- Disposez les dossiers sur le dessus.
- Couper et coller.
- Touches de raccourci globales.
- "Copier le chemin", "Afficher les éléments cachés", "Masquer le bureau", "Rafraîchir", "Nouveau fichier", "Copier vers", "Déplacer vers", "Nouveau terminal ici", "Faire un lien symbolique", "Contenu", "Attributs", .
- Ancienne étiquette pour OSX 10.9 & 10.10. Texte clair sur fond sombre. Fenêtre transparente.
- Icônes colorées dans la barre latérale.
- Taille des éléments sélectionnés dans la barre d'état.
- Ajustement automatique de la largeur des colonnes.
- Appuyez sur Entrée ou Retour pour ouvrir la sélection.
- Afficher le nombre d'éléments du dossier en vue Liste.
- Cliquez au centre pour ouvrir le dossier dans une nouvelle fenêtre ou un nouvel onglet.
- Beaucoup plus.
J'utilise cette application avec OS X 10.9.5 et je n'ai rencontré aucun problème avec elle. Elle a un style d'icônes natif d'OS X qui est bien adapté aux écrans retina. Voici une capture d'écran de ma barre d'outils Finder.
Ps. cette application est également gratuite !
Nouveau fichier Applescript avec icône de barre d'outils
J'ai trouvé ce joyau open source. On peut soit utiliser le .App, soit ajouter l'Applescript manuellement. Ajoutera un widget Nouveau fichier à la barre d'outils du Finder.
Comment créer un service Automator (OS X El Capitan 10.11.5) :
Ouvrir Automator et sélectionnez Fichier > Nouveau > Service .
Ensuite, choisissez Dossiers dans le menu déroulant Le service reçoit une sélection ...
Dans le Actions rechercher et ajouter dans le menu Exécuter AppleSript ou le glisser-déposer à partir de la page Utilitaires catégorie.
Copiez et collez ce script dans le fichier Exécuter une action AppleScript :
tell application "Finder" to make new file at (the target of the front window) as alias with properties {name:"untitled.txt"}
Enregistrez le service en tant que Nouveau fichier texte ou similaire.
Vous devriez maintenant pouvoir faire un clic droit sur un dossier et trouver Services > Nouveau fichier texte .
Note : Vous obtiendrez une erreur si vous essayez d'ajouter une deuxième sans titre.txt dans le même dossier.
Si vous ne spécifiez pas le nom du fichier, le service numérotera les fichiers comme suit untitled
entonces untitled 2
et ainsi de suite sans provoquer d'erreur.
Cela fonctionne très bien, merci. Y a-t-il un moyen d'ajouter deux fonctionnalités ? Le nouveau fichier peut-il être enregistré directement sous le nom "newfile.txt" ? Pour le moment, je n'obtiens l'option Services que lorsque je clique avec le bouton droit de la souris sur une icône de dossier. Y a-t-il un moyen d'obtenir cette option en cliquant sur une fenêtre du Finder ?
Y a-t-il un moyen de faire en sorte qu'il ne soit pas nécessaire de faire un clic droit sur un dossier ? J'espérais pouvoir le faire en faisant un simple clic droit sur un espace vide dans une fenêtre du Finder.
Il existe une méthode très simple utilisant touchez dans Automator :
Créer un nouveau service dans Automator
Configurez-le pour recevoir les "fichiers ou dossiers" sélectionnés dans le Finder.
Ajouter un shell d'exécution script avec l'entrée Pass "as arguments" et coller ce code dans le shell :
for d in "$@"; do
cd "$d"
touch untitled.txt
done
Sauvegardez-le.
Et si vous voulez y ajouter un raccourci clavier, allez dans Préférences système > Clavier.
Profitez-en ^^
Le code ci-dessus nécessite qu'un dossier soit sélectionné pour fonctionner, et ne fait rien si un fichier est sélectionné. En remplaçant le code du shell script par le bout de code ci-dessous, les fichiers seront également gérés et un fichier vide sera créé à côté du fichier sélectionné :
for df in "$@"; do
if [[ -d "$df" ]]; then
d="$df"
elif [[ -e "$df" ]]; then
d="$(dirname "$df")"
fi
touch "$d"/empty.txt
done
Ça a l'air super -- je ne savais pas qu'on pouvait exécuter des scripts comme ça ; je n'ai jamais voulu prendre le temps d'apprendre Applescript, c'est tellement ésotérique
Ajout d'une petite suggestion de modification pour bien gérer les fichiers -- dans mon test, le code original ne faisait rien lorsque le service était exécuté alors qu'une fichier a été sélectionné, plutôt qu'un dossier
Voici mon pour créer de nouveaux fichiers à partir d'un magasin de modèles.
Je l'exécute avec FastScripts en utilisant un raccourci clavier, mais vous pouvez l'enregistrer dans une applet et la mettre dans la barre de menu, créer une action automator, etc.
-ccs
\----------------------------------------------------------------------------
-- Author: Christopher Stone
-- Created: 2012-10-26 : 01:27
-- Modified: 2012-10-26 : 18:26
-- Application: Finder
-- Purpose: Create a new file from a file-type list in the front Finder window using
-- : template files stored in a folder.
-- Dependencies: Template files provided by the user.
-- Templates: Auto-creates a Text template - others are for the user to supply.
----------------------------------------------------------------------------
try
try
set templateFolderPath to ((path to application support from user domain as text) & "Script\_Support:New\_File\_Here!:")
set templateFolder to alias templateFolderPath
on error
set newFilesHereFolder to quoted form of (POSIX path of templateFolderPath)
set textTemplate to newFilesHereFolder & "Text\_Template.txt"
do shell script "mkdir -p " & newFilesHereFolder & ";
touch " & textTemplate & ";
open -R " & textTemplate
return
end try
tell application "Finder"
if front window exists then
set winTarget to target of front window as alias
set fileTemplateList to name of files of templateFolder
tell me to set fileType to choose from list fileTemplateList with title "New\_File\_Here! Templates" with prompt ¬
"Pick One or More:" default items {get item 1 of fileTemplateList} with multiple selections allowed
if fileType != false then
set AppleScript's text item delimiters to (return & templateFolderPath)
set itemsToCopy to paragraphs of ((templateFolder as text) & fileType)
repeat with i in itemsToCopy
set i's contents to i as alias
end repeat
set copiedFiles to duplicate itemsToCopy to winTarget
select copiedFiles
end if
else
error "No windows open in Finder!"
end if
end tell
on error e number n
set e to e & return & return & "Num: " & n
tell me to set dDlg to display dialog e with title "ERROR!" buttons {"Cancel", "Copy", "OK"} default button "OK"
if button returned of dDlg = "Copy" then set the clipboard to e
end try
----------------------------------------------------------------------------
LesApples est une communauté de Apple où vous pouvez résoudre vos problèmes et vos doutes. Vous pouvez consulter les questions des autres utilisateurs d'appareils Apple, poser vos propres questions ou résoudre celles des autres.
30 votes
Je n'arrive pas à croire que cette tâche soit si difficile. Les réponses ci-dessous fonctionnent, mais bonne chance pour les expliquer à un ami ou un membre de la famille qui n'est pas technicien.
4 votes
Dans Mac, il n'est pas évident de savoir comment
1 votes
youtube.com/watch?v=sE_V0vzNTWQ